Panther Cub (2021)

Porter - Other

A robust porter, Panther Cub is aged in the finest bourbon barrels available along with a kiss of maple syrup and vanilla extract. The aroma of maple and vanilla notes combine with a surprisingly deep character to make this rare creature one to gaze upon fondly. Don’t let it fool you, this kitty has claws.
